How often should you wash your hair—and which products suit that rhythm? This quick, no-sign-up quiz compares your scalp changes, texture, activity, styling habits, and wash-day experience across four practical schedules. Your highest score shows your strongest affinity; results within one point suggest a blended routine. Use the result as a starting point rather than a medical rule. Persistent itching, pain, sores, sudden hair loss, or severe flaking deserves advice from a qualified healthcare professional.
